Возвращаемые значения проверки подлинности
Значения поставщика сети
API поставщика сети использует следующие определенные значения.
Ценность | Описание |
---|---|
возвращаемые значения безопасности сети |
Возвращает значения, которые может задать поставщик сети. |
Возвращаемые значения смарт-карт
функции смарт-карт возвращают следующие возвращаемые значения. Эти возвращаемые значения определены в Scarderr.h.
Заметка
Некоторые возвращаемые значения могут иметь то же значение, что и существующие возвращаемые значения Windows, указывающие на аналогичное условие. Сведения о кодах ошибок, не перечисленных здесь, см. в системных кодов ошибок.
Ценность | Описание |
---|---|
ERROR_BROKEN_PIPE 0x00000109 |
Клиент попытался выполнить операцию смарт-карты в удаленном сеансе, например сеанс клиента, запущенный на сервере терминала, и операционная система, используемая, не поддерживает перенаправление смарт-карт. |
SCARD_E_BAD_SEEK 0x80100029 |
Произошла ошибка при настройке указателя объекта файла смарт-карты. |
SCARD_E_CANCELLED 0x80100002 |
Действие было отменено запросом SCardCancel. |
SCARD_E_CANT_DISPOSE 0x8010000E |
Система не могла удалить носитель запрошенным способом. |
SCARD_E_CARD_UNSUPPORTED 0x8010001C |
Смарт-карта не соответствует минимальным требованиям для поддержки. |
SCARD_E_CERTIFICATE_UNAVAILABLE 0x8010002D |
Не удалось получить запрошенный сертификат. |
SCARD_E_COMM_DATA_LOST 0x8010002F |
Обнаружена ошибка связи с смарт-картой. |
SCARD_E_DIR_NOT_FOUND 0x80100023 |
Указанный каталог не существует в смарт-карте. |
SCARD_E_DUPLICATE_READER 0x8010001B |
Драйверсредства чтенияне создает уникальное имя средства чтения. |
SCARD_E_FILE_NOT_FOUND 0x80100024 |
Указанный файл не существует в смарт-карте. |
SCARD_E_ICC_CREATEORDER 0x80100021 |
Запрошенный порядок создания объекта не поддерживается. |
SCARD_E_ICC_INSTALLATION 0x80100020 |
Основной поставщик не найден для смарт-карты. |
SCARD_E_INSUFFICIENT_BUFFER 0x80100008 |
Буфер данных для возвращаемых данных слишком мал для возвращаемых данных. |
SCARD_E_INVALID_ATR 0x80100015 |
Строка ATR , полученная из реестра, не является допустимой строкой ATR. |
SCARD_E_INVALID_CHV 0x8010002A |
Указанный ПИН-код неверный. |
SCARD_E_INVALID_HANDLE 0x80100003 |
Предоставленный дескриптор недействителен. |
SCARD_E_INVALID_PARAMETER 0x80100004 |
Не удалось правильно интерпретировать один или несколько указанных параметров. |
SCARD_E_INVALID_TARGET 0x80100005 |
Сведения о запуске реестра отсутствуют или недопустимы. |
SCARD_E_INVALID_VALUE 0x80100011 |
Не удалось правильно интерпретировать одно или несколько указанных значений параметров. |
SCARD_E_NO_ACCESS 0x80100027 |
Доступ к файлу запрещен. |
SCARD_E_NO_DIR 0x80100025 |
Указанный путь не представляет каталог смарт-карт. |
SCARD_E_NO_FILE 0x80100026 |
Указанный путь не представляет файл смарт-карты. |
SCARD_E_NO_KEY_CONTAINER 0x80100030 |
Запрошенный контейнер ключей не существует на смарт-карте. |
SCARD_E_NO_MEMORY 0x80100006 |
Недостаточно памяти для выполнения этой команды. |
SCARD_E_NO_PIN_CACHE 0x80100033 |
ПИН-код смарт-карты нельзя кэшировать. Windows Server 2008, Windows Vista, Windows Server 2003 и Windows XP: этот код ошибки недоступен. |
SCARD_E_NO_READERS_AVAILABLE 0x8010002E |
Средство чтения смарт-карт недоступно. |
SCARD_E_NO_SERVICE 0x8010001D |
диспетчер ресурсовсмарт-карты не запущен. |
SCARD_E_NO_SMARTCARD 0x8010000C |
Для операции требуется смарт-карта, но в настоящее время на устройстве нет смарт-карты. |
SCARD_E_NO_SUCH_CERTIFICATE 0x8010002C |
Запрошенный сертификат не существует. |
SCARD_E_NOT_READY 0x80100010 |
Читатель или карточка не готовы принимать команды. |
SCARD_E_NOT_TRANSACTED 0x80100016 |
Предпринята попытка положить конец несуществующей транзакции. |
SCARD_E_PCI_TOO_SMALL 0x80100019 |
Буфер приема PCI слишком мал. |
SCARD_E_PIN_CACHE_EXPIRED 0x80100032 |
Срок действия кэша ПИН-кода смарт-карты истек. Windows Server 2008, Windows Vista, Windows Server 2003 и Windows XP: этот код ошибки недоступен. |
SCARD_E_PROTO_MISMATCH 0x8010000F |
Запрошенные протоколы несовместимы с протоколом, используемым в настоящее время с карточкой. |
SCARD_E_READ_ONLY_CARD 0x80100034 |
Смарт-карта доступна только для чтения и не может быть записана в нее. Windows Server 2008, Windows Vista, Windows Server 2003 и Windows XP: этот код ошибки недоступен. |
SCARD_E_READER_UNAVAILABLE 0x80100017 |
Указанное средство чтения в настоящее время недоступно для использования. |
SCARD_E_READER_UNSUPPORTED 0x8010001A |
Драйвер чтения не соответствует минимальным требованиям для поддержки. |
SCARD_E_SERVER_TOO_BUSY 0x80100031 |
Диспетчер ресурсов смарт-карт слишком занят для выполнения этой операции. |
SCARD_E_SERVICE_STOPPED 0x8010001E |
Диспетчер ресурсов смарт-карты завершил работу. |
SCARD_E_SHARING_VIOLATION 0x8010000B |
Доступ к смарт-карте невозможен из-за других невыполненных подключений. |
SCARD_E_SYSTEM_CANCELLED 0x80100012 |
Действие было отменено системой, предположительно для выхода или отключения. |
SCARD_E_TIMEOUT 0x8010000A |
Истек срок ожидания, указанный пользователем. |
SCARD_E_UNEXPECTED 0x8010001F |
Произошла непредвиденная ошибка карты. |
SCARD_E_UNKNOWN_CARD 0x8010000D |
Указанное имя смарт-карты не распознается. |
SCARD_E_UNKNOWN_READER 0x80100009 |
Указанное имя средства чтения не распознается. |
SCARD_E_UNKNOWN_RES_MNG 0x8010002B |
Возвращен нераспознанный код ошибки. |
SCARD_E_UNSUPPORTED_FEATURE 0x80100022 |
Эта смарт-карта не поддерживает запрошенную функцию. |
SCARD_E_WRITE_TOO_MANY 0x80100028 |
Предпринята попытка записать больше данных, чем будет соответствовать целевому объекту. |
SCARD_F_COMM_ERROR 0x80100013 |
Обнаружена внутренняя ошибка связи. |
SCARD_F_INTERNAL_ERROR 0x80100001 |
Сбой внутренней проверки согласованности. |
SCARD_F_UNKNOWN_ERROR 0x80100014 |
Обнаружена внутренняя ошибка, но источник неизвестен. |
SCARD_F_WAITED_TOO_LONG 0x80100007 |
Истек срок действия внутреннего таймера согласованности. |
SCARD_P_SHUTDOWN 0x80100018 |
Операция была прервана, чтобы разрешить серверу приложению выйти. |
SCARD_S_SUCCESS |
Ошибка не обнаружена. |
SCARD_W_CANCELLED_BY_USER 0x8010006E |
Действие было отменено пользователем. |
SCARD_W_CACHE_ITEM_NOT_FOUND 0x80100070 |
Запрошенный элемент не найден в кэше. |
SCARD_W_CACHE_ITEM_STALE 0x80100071 |
Запрошенный элемент кэша слишком старый и был удален из кэша. |
SCARD_W_CACHE_ITEM_TOO_BIG 0x80100072 |
Новый элемент кэша превышает максимальный размер каждого элемента, определенный для кэша. |
SCARD_W_CARD_NOT_AUTHENTICATED 0x8010006F |
Пин-код не был представлен смарт-карте. |
SCARD_W_CHV_BLOCKED 0x8010006C |
Доступ к карте невозможен, так как достигнуто максимальное количество попыток ввода ПИН-кода. |
SCARD_W_EOF 0x8010006D |
Достигнут конец файла смарт-карты. |
SCARD_W_REMOVED_CARD 0x80100069 |
Смарт-карта удалена, поэтому дальнейшее взаимодействие невозможно. |
SCARD_W_RESET_CARD 0x80100068 |
Смарт-карта была сброшена. |
SCARD_W_SECURITY_VIOLATION 0x8010006A |
Доступ был отклонен из-за нарушения безопасности. |
SCARD_W_UNPOWERED_CARD 0x80100067 |
Питание было удалено из смарт-карты, поэтому дальнейшее взаимодействие невозможно. |
SCARD_W_UNRESPONSIVE_CARD 0x80100066 |
Смарт-карта не отвечает на сброс. |
SCARD_W_UNSUPPORTED_CARD 0x80100065 |
Читатель не может взаимодействовать с карточкой из-за конфликтов конфигурации строки ATR. |
SCARD_W_WRONG_CHV 0x8010006B |
Не удается получить доступ к карточке, так как был представлен неправильный ПИН-код. |